About Us

The Financial Ombudsman Service is an independent, not-for-profit organisation that plays a vital role in UK financial services. Every day we help resolve disputes between consumers, or small businesses, and their financial service providers.

As Platform Engineering Manager, you are accountable for the end-to-end lifecycle, strategy, and delivery of the organisation’s core technology platforms across both public and private cloud environments. This role sits within the wider IT Infrastructure team, working collaboratively to ensure that platform services are seamlessly integrated and enable agility, scalability, and resilience throughout the organisation’s digital landscape.

What You’ll Do

As part of a cloud-first organisation, you are expected to champion and accelerate the adoption of cloud technologies, ensuring that solutions are modern, scalable, and secure. While primarily a management position, this is a blended role that also requires direct hands-on involvement when necessary — whether in technical problem-solving, implementation, or supporting the team during critical periods.

You will ensure that platform engineering solutions are customer-centric, deliver measurable business value, and align with the organisation’s strategic vision. Leading a cross-functional team, you will work closely with business stakeholders, product owners, and technical experts to deliver innovative, reliable, and secure platforms that underpin the organisation’s operational and strategic objectives.

To be considered for this role, you’ll need to show us that you’ve got the skills and capabilities. You’ll have to meet the following minimum criteria:

  • Proven experience managing platform engineering or DevOps teams in hybrid (public/private cloud) environments. You will be skilled in coaching, developing and managing performance.
  • Deep expertise in cloud platforms (Azure) and private cloud technologies (VMware, Nutanix).
  • Strong background in infrastructure automation (Terraform, CI/CD, Kubernetes).
  • Practical application of security best practices, compliance, and risk management in cloud and hybrid settings.
  • Track record of delivering scalable, reliable, and secure platform solutions.
  • Proven experience of working with senior leadership as well as stakeholders across all levels. You will be able to communicate effectively with technical and non-technical stakeholders, as well as capably manage 3rd party vendors.
